3. Overview
In recent years, South East Asia
agriculture has experienced profound and
rapid changes. The joint process of
deforestation, new land extension and
agricultural intensification has often led
to vast soil erosion and gradual soil
exhaustion. CA has considerably improved
situation.

10. Conservation Agriculture is an agro ecological
approach associating rural development with
environmental preservation.
It is a generic concept integrating the whole
agricultural practices & aiming both at viability and
sustainability of agriculture and environment
protection.

27. Perspective of CA in
China(Yunan),Laos and Vietnam
5th WCCA, Brisbane, Australia, September 26-29
28. • Conservation
Agriculture
LAOS`s case
1- Government Decree on adoption of
SCV-CA as promising technic for Agri-
production and need for Integration
SCV- CA into the cursus of Agri-Facult
No554 dated (21/4/2005)

32. Perspective of CA
• Case of LAOS
Establishment of Provincial Conservation Agriculture
Development Fund in 2009 (Sayaboury).
5060 ha.(7000ha CA Laos) Farmer adoption of CA for Maize
production in South Sayaboury Province.
A lot of CA technologies being used in among Rural
Development Project within the Country

34. Conservation Agriculture has to compete with the
“Traders’ systems” offering the same level of
mechanization performance and then attract private
service providers who presently prefer make money with
the plowing business.
Research will accompany the development by creating
innovation to be tested with and for farmers.
Extension Services will perform a real support
Farmers’ groups will get official status authorizing
access to credit facilities at normal rate…

35. We need supports to develop and disseminate CA according to the
three regional priorities we have defined:
- Intensify and diversify uplands farming systems;
- Restoration of the fertility of degraded soils;
- Improve Capacity Building of our Engineers and Technicians.
We need to develop new scientific / development partnerships and
new technical exchanges with organizations, institutions , private
sectors
We need support from Donors to fund regional rural development
programs based on CA to produce more while protecting our natural
resources on this proposed theme
